Advantages of Cat Flaps

Before we dive into the importance of a local cat flap installer, let's discuss the advantages of cat flaps. Here are some of the benefits of installing a cat flap in your house:
Convenience: A electronic cat flap installation flap permits your cat to come and go as they please, without the need for manual intervention.Liberty: Your cat will appreciate the freedom to enter and leave your home without relying on you to open the door.Energy Efficiency: By setting up a cat flap, you can lower heat loss and energy usage, as your cat will no longer need to depend on an open door or window to enter and exit your home.Security: Modern cat flaps come with advanced security functions, such as magnetic closure and brush seals, to avoid unwanted animals from entering your home.

Often Asked Questions

Q: What is the average cost of a cat flap installation?A: The typical cost of a cat flap installation varies depending on the size and kind of cat flap, in addition to the intricacy of the installation. Usually, you can expect to pay between ₤ 100 and ₤ 500.

Q: How long does a cat flap installation take?A: The length of time it takes to install a cat flap differs depending upon the intricacy of the installation. On average, you can anticipate the installation to take between 1-3 hours.

Q: Can I set up a cat flap myself?A: While it is possible to install a cat flap yourself, it is not suggested unless you have experience with DIY jobs and are confident in your ability to perform the work correctly.
